When disability is a factor in adolescent behaviour
Karen Dimmock is the CEO of the Association for Children with Disability (ACD). Working with more than 5,000 families across Victoria each year, ACD is the leading organisation advocating for children with disability and their families in Victoria. Karen’s presentation, ‘When disability is a factor in adolescent behaviour’ explores:
- Behaviour as communication
- Experience of families
- Intersection of disability, mental health, family violence and mental health of mothers
- What works to promote positive behaviour
- What will the NDIS pay for
- What doesn’t work
- Expanding your knowledge and practice
